#778cbd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#778cbd is composed of 46.7% red, 54.9%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37% cyan, 25.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 222 degrees, a saturation of 34.7% and a lightness of 60.4%. #778cbd color hex could be obtained by blending #eeffff with #00197b.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#778cbd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#778cbd has RGB values of R:119, G:140,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 7834813.

Shades and Tints of #778cbd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040609 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fd is the lightest one.
